Henry Fong's eclectic take on dance music soaks through via his sweat-filled club banger "Jump Up." Brimming with party sirens, spicy rhythms and brash global bass sounds, the Florida producer makes a compelling mix of grit and sheen.

Between spending his days enjoying the beach and nights performing at the club, producer and DJ Henry Fong can be found in the studio crafting high-energy bangers. With a signature sound that fuses elements of dancehall, reggae and electro house, this year has seen the esteemed producer continue to be a singular voice in dance music’s evolving landscape. “Jump Up” caps what’s been a momentous 2019 for Fong, following his excellent Fong Island EP, which featured the Rome Ramierz (Sublime with Rome)-led single “On My Way.” His year was also highlighted by “Pica” alongside Deorro and Elvis Crespo, as well as mainstage-smasher “Rave Tool,” which received DJ support from the likes of Skrillex, The Chainsmokers and Flosstradamus.

Boasting multiple placements in the Beatport Top 10, as well as releases on Dim Mak, OWSLA, Hysteria, Mad Decent, Revealed, Spinnin’, Musical Freedom and more, the South Florida native has established a solid reputation as a beatmaker and party starter over the years. “Jump Up” is the latest step in the evolution of Fong’s frenetic sound, painted with exotic grooves fit to serve sound systems in South Beach, SoCal and beyond.
